Tips for Planning a Winter Self-Driving Trip:
- Check the weather forecast before you go. The weather in the Alps can be unpredictable, so it's important to be prepared for all types of conditions.
- Pack warm clothes. You'll need layers of clothing that can be easily removed or added to, as the temperature can fluctuate greatly in the Alps.
- Bring a map and GPS device. A physical map and GPS device can be helpful if you're not familiar with the area.
- Be aware of your surroundings. Pay attention to traffic, weather, and other vehicles.
- Respect the environment. Leave no trace and be mindful of wildlife.
